Solution - Linear equations with one unknown
x=5
Step by Step Solution
Rearrange:
Rearrange the equation by subtracting what is to the right of the equal sign from both sides of the equation :
4*(2*x-9)-(4)=0
Step by step solution :
Step 1 :
Equation at the end of step 1 :
4 • (2x - 9) - 4 = 0
Step 2 :
Pulling out like terms :
2.1 Pull out 4
After pulling out, we are left with :
4 • ( 1 * (2x-9) +( (-1) ))
Step 3 :
Pulling out like terms :
3.1 Pull out like factors :
2x - 10 = 2 • (x - 5)
Equation at the end of step 3 :
8 • (x - 5) = 0
Step 4 :
Equations which are never true :
4.1 Solve : 8 = 0
This equation has no solution.
A a non-zero constant never equals zero.
Solving a Single Variable Equation :
4.2 Solve : x-5 = 0
Add 5 to both sides of the equation :
x = 5
One solution was found :
